在HTML中引用时显示背景图像,但在CSS中引用时则不显示

时间:2015-07-08 23:02:08

标签: html css background background-image

我的css文件与我的html文件位于同一目录中,背景图像文件存在于images目录中。它显示我是否直接将其放入body标签,但如果我在css文件中引用它则不会显示。目录结构是root - images,html& css在root中,图片在图片中。

HTML:

</body></html>

...当然还有文件的其余部分,以body { padding: none; margin: auto; background: #ccc url("images/mainbg.jpg") repeat-x fixed top left, url("images/body-x2.png") repeat-x fixed bottom left; } 结尾。

CSS:

  year1997up<-0
  year1997up[year>1997]<-year[year>1997]-1997
  year1997up[year<=1997]<-rep(0,sum(year<=1997))
  year1997down<-0
  year1997down[year<1997]<-year[year<1997]-1995
  year1997down[year>=1997]<-rep(2,sum(year>=1997))

1 个答案:

答案 0 :(得分:2)

摆脱背景颜色声明#ccc,并确保如果<body>中没有内容,你也声明了100vh的高度或类似的内容。

codepen example